Their grandfather was a celebrity during the golden age for Jews in Iran. So why ...

Cleveland Jewish News 08 Mar 2024
Known as the “Nightingale of Iran” for his powerful voice, Younes Dardashti was the only Jewish singer in the history of recorded classical Persian music to win broad national acclaim as an “ustad,” or “maestro,” vocalist.
